Kamienica, Limanowa County

Kamienica [kamjɛˈnit͡sa] is a village in Limanowa County, Lesser Poland Voivodeship, in southern Poland. It is the seat of the gmina (administrative district) called Gmina Kamienica. It lies approximately 17 kilometres (11 mi) south-west of Limanowa and 62 km (39 mi) south-east of the regional capital Kraków.[1]

Notable residents

  • Czesław Kukuczka (1935–1974), one of only two known foreign nationals (non-German descent and non-German resident) casualty of the Berlin Wall.
